Aeroponics systems basically use humidified air instead of soil and water to grow the plants. The whole idea is to have a different growing medium for the plants than the conventional soil and water one. There are many advantages of using aeroponics; how to use it to your advantage is what is of importance.

Along with water as the growing medium aeroponics, it also uses the essential minerals for sustaining the healthy growth of the plants. The science behind aeroponics, how to grow plants with humid air, is that plants do not need the soil in any way for the transmission of nutrients required for growth. The mineral nutrients present in the soil are transmitted with the help of the water the plants consume. This is the whole premise of aeroponics; how to make the plants grow with just water and minerals minus the soil.

Homemade aeroponics systems are quite effective and obviously cheaper too. The advantages of aeroponics are much greater than drawbacks, if any. The plants grow faster, the yield is better, the health of the plantation is better and the space required is much lesser than a conventional soil grown garden.

Aeroponic is especially suitable for the city dwellers that love to have greenery around them but are hard-pressed for open spaces. Generally aeroponic plants are suspended from a reservoir and the nutrition is provided to them using a spray nozzle. This type of gardening is apt for indoor gardens as the mess is also negligible and the plants are also lush green and healthy. Although aeroponics is sometimes confused to be hydroponics both are actually quite different gardening techniques.
